Offering 200 Acres of high quality Ringgold County, Iowa, farmland located on pavement (High and Dry) just south of Creston, Iowa. Farm consists of 167 FSA tillable acres with an average CSR2 of 58.2.The balance of the farm consists of timber, ponds and creeks. The farm is currently a well established pasture but can be easily converted to tillable row crop acres. This property would be a great add-on for a current operation or also a ideal tract for an investor wishing to diversify their portfolio. The primary soil types include Zook-Ely, Nira and Sharpsburg silty clay loams. Farm also provides recreational opportunities with established trees and ponds. The farm is located in Section 11 of Lincoln Township.
